## Points of issue
Wrappers, Auerhahn Press, San Francisco; the eighth Auerhahn title, in roughly 1,000 copies. Printed white wrappers lettered in red and black with a Brion Gysin calligraphic design in green. Co-authored with Brion Gysin and distinct from Burroughs' later, unrelated 'Exterminator!' (1973).

## Is this the true first?
True first is the 1960 Auerhahn wrappered original. A small signed/limited issue with original Gysin artwork also exists.
